Episode Description

The Affordable Care Act kicks into full gear on January first and with it comes new rules with how company wellness programs are regulated. Wellness plan administrators across the nation are checking to make sure all the i’s are dotted and the t’s are crossed. Judith Wethall, Littler employee benefits attorney, will share with us the compliance issues surrounding such things as HIPAA non-discrimination, ERISA rules, safe harbor language, reasonable alternatives, incentives and why tobacco usage is treated differently. And even though the Employer Mandate has been delayed until 2015, it’s time to start reviewing your plans now. We'll also take a look at how the ACA interacts with other laws, such as the ADA, ADEA and GINA.

Susan Doherty

Susan Doherty’s goal is to get everyone moving towards better health. She previously managed the wellness programs for a restaurant chain with up to 50,000 employees nationwide. There she implemented premium incentive programs, biometric screenings, activity based pay-for-prevention and employee coaching programs. She also managed a corporate gym, weight loss programming, anti-smoking campaigns and national health discounts. Susan was also the onsite ergonomic program manager for up to 800 corporate employees.

Susan holds a Human Resources Certification from San Diego State and is a Certified Ergonomic Assessment Specialist and a passionate health coach. She is a member of the National Association of Women Business Owners, currently sits on the Board of Directors of NAWBO-SD and is a member of the Society of Human Resources Management. She is a past board member of the Corporate Health and Wellness Assoc. and past winner of the Corporate Wellness Leadership Award through CHWA, a past presenter at their national conference and other wellness conferences.

Her businesses include The Healthy Well, a corporate wellness company, Working Wellness Solutions and Action Ergonomics.
